William ralph “billy” talbert ii, of des moines, iowa, was killed in a drive-by shooting in des moines early sunday morning, september 3, 1995, as he stood on a sidewalk.Police said more than a dozen bullets were fired out of a speeding car shortly after 4 a.M.Talbert, 18, was shot in the head and later died in surgery.Police were looking for a white monte carlo sedan with a torn white vinyl roof.Antonio nelson, 18, and thomas buckner, 19, were later arrested and charged with murder in talbert’s death. In a cedar rapids gazette / ap story dated dec. 28, 1995, polk county attorney john sarcone said the case against nelson and buckner was dropped because some witnesses changed their story to police, leaving insufficient evidence to make a strong case.
